Why does your dog need routine grooming?

Frequent grooming of your pet not only keeps your pet’s coat looking smooth, but it also helps maintain your pet’s skin and physical health and wellbeing. When your dog gets groomed, it prevents painful tangling and knots in their hair, reduces the growth of bacteria and hot-spots (dermatitis), and keeps thepet clear from pests like bugs. During your pet’s grooming session, your Peakhurst Heights pet groomer will keep an eye out for bumps and injuries that could be a health problem.


How often should my dog be groomed?

Grooming needs for your dog will vary depending on the breed, hair and your dog’s habits. Normally, dogs with short coats including Beagles, Bulldogs and Labradors require less grooming than dogs with long coats like Poodles, Border Collies and Pomeranians. As a general rule, most pet parents book regular grooming on a monthly basis. For pups and dogs who have not been groomed yet, more regular grooming at home should be done to get the dog used to being handled and to avoid grooming problems as they grow up. What’s the difference between a dog bathing and grooming service?

Dog bathing services include: 1-3 rounds of shampoo, 1 round of conditioner, hand-dry as permitted by dog, brushing and/or comb out.

Dog grooming include: Everything included from bathing plus a full cut/style based on breed standards and/or your specific needs, nails trimmed, and ears cleaned.

How old should my puppy be before he gets his 1st groom?

It is ideal to have your pup end up being acquainted with grooming as young as possible after the first series of puppy shots, usually 12-16 weeks old. This will help him discover at an early age that grooming is a pleasant experience.

Why does my canine smell even after grooming?

There are numerous reasons why a pet’s skin may be compromised, resulting in a skin disease. Allergies, hormone imbalances, fungal contaminations, external parasites, inflammation, wounds, bleeding tumors, and other skin issues can cause bacteria and fungus on the skin’s surface area to take hold and bring about vile stenches.

What is fluff drying a pet?

Fluff drying involves using a blow dryer to straighten and volumize your dog’s hair. Your pet groomer in Peakhurst Heights NSW does this to make it easier to cut the hair straight. Nevertheless, the side benefit is that the method provides your pet dog that adorable, fluffy look.



Is it OK to brush your pet daily?

You ought to brush your dog every couple of days regardless of the length of his coat. Sometimes your brushing can have a particular purpose, such as getting rid of hair mats or assisting your canine shed his seasonal coat, however usually you’ll be carrying out general-purpose brushing or combing.
